Turns out, your chances to become a central service technician are better in some states than others.In order to help you decide which state is the best for central service technicians, we ranked all 50 states and the District of Columbia from best to worst for central service technician jobs.
Arizona is the best state for jobs for central service technicians, and Maryland is the worst. The most common pay in Arizona is $43,486, while the median pay in Maryland is $28,542.Arizona is the best state, and Mililani Town is the city with the highest pay for central service technicians.
